Frequently Asked Questions

Can I work remotely from Tajikistan?

With 0.1 fixed broadband subscriptions per 100 people, Tajikistan can support video calls in major cities. The hard part is paperwork — visa category, employer policy on overseas staff, and tax residency in Kyrgyzstan and Tajikistan.

Is Tajikistan safe for expats?

Kyrgyzstan performs better than Tajikistan across all safety metrics.

How is healthcare in Tajikistan compared to Kyrgyzstan?

Kyrgyzstan generally does better on health & wellbeing, though Tajikistan leads in adult obesity rate. There are 21.3 doctors per 10,000 people in Tajikistan, compared to 21.5 in Kyrgyzstan. Tajikistan scores 67 on the WHO universal health coverage index (Kyrgyzstan: 69).

What's the weather like in Tajikistan compared to Kyrgyzstan?

The average high temperature in Dushanbe is 72°F, compared to 90°F in Bishkek. Dushanbe receives around 25.7 in of rainfall per year, while Bishkek gets 17.8 in.

What language do they speak in Tajikistan?

The official languages in Tajikistan are Russian and Tajik. In Kyrgyzstan, the official languages are Kyrgyz and Russian.
